What's The Definition Of Anapestic?

[adj] (of a metric foot) characterized by two short syllables followed by a long one

Anapestic In Webster's Dictionary

\An`a*pes"tic\, a. [L. anapaesticus, Gr. ?.] Pertaining to an anapest; consisting of an anapests; as, an anapestic meter, foot, verse. -- n. Anapestic measure or verse.
